Effective CAT 2026 mock analysis requires a systematic review of every attempt, focusing on identifying error patterns rather than just scores. We at Exam Bhai advise categorizing mistakes into conceptual gaps, calculation errors, or time-management failures. Rigorous post-mock review ensures you convert lessons into actionable improvements, directly increasing your total percentile.

What is the Exam?

The Common Admission Test (CAT) is the gateway to India’s premier management institutes, including the Indian Institutes of Management (IIMs). It is a highly competitive, computer-based standardized test designed to assess quantitative ability, data interpretation, verbal ability, and logical reasoning. For aspirants targeting the 2026 academic cycle, CAT is not merely a test of knowledge but a test of endurance and strategic execution. Syllabus 2026

The CAT syllabus is vast, spanning three core sections. While no official weightage is fixed by the IIMs, historical trends indicate a consistent distribution.

SectionCore TopicsFocus Areas
VARCReading Comprehension, Para Jumbles, SummaryInference-based questions
DILRSeating Arrangement, Graphs, Data TablesLogical puzzles and reasoning
QAArithmetic, Algebra, Geometry, Number SystemsCalculation speed and shortcuts

Eligibility Criteria

As per the official guidelines established by the IIMs and accessible via iimcat.ac.in, candidates must hold a Bachelor’s degree with at least 50% marks or equivalent CGPA (45% for SC, ST, and PwD categories). Preparation Strategy

Effective preparation involves a cycle of learning, practicing, and analyzing. To sharpen your skills, we recommend that you practice previous year papers for Management on Exam Bhai to understand the DNA of the exam. When conducting mock analysis, follow the "Three-Layer Review" method:

  1. Layer 1: The Accuracy Audit. Identify questions you got wrong. Was it a concept you didn't know, or a silly calculation error?
  2. Layer 2: The Efficiency Check. Did you spend more than 3 minutes on a question that had a simple shortcut? Use our advanced mock analytics for Management on Exam Bhai to track your time-per-question.
  3. Layer 3: The Strategy Refinement. Update your "Error Log"—a notebook where you document every recurring mistake. Review this log before every new mock to ensure you don't repeat the same errors.

Cut-Off Trends

Cut-offs are determined by the participating IIMs and are published on the official iimcat.ac.in portal. Historically, top IIMs maintain sectional cut-offs above 80-85 percentile, with overall requirements ranging from 95-99+ percentile. We strongly advise students to focus on sectional balance rather than just overall scores, as many top-tier institutes will reject candidates who fail to clear the minimum sectional hurdle.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q1: How many mocks should I take before CAT 2026? A: We recommend 25-30 high-quality mocks. Quality analysis is more important than the raw number of tests taken.

Q2: Should I analyze mocks on the same day? A: Yes. Analyzing immediately after the mock ensures the reasoning process for each question is still fresh in your mind.

Q3: What is the TITA section? A: Type-In-The-Answer (TITA) questions have no negative marking. They should be prioritized as they pose less risk to your score.

Q4: How do I handle a low score in a mock? A: View low scores as data, not failure. Use them to identify which topics require immediate remediation before the next test.

Q5: Is sectional timing fixed? A: Yes, CAT enforces a 40-minute limit per section, regardless of how much time you save in other sections.

Q6: What is the most important part of mock analysis? A: Identifying your "Selectivity Bias"—learning which questions to skip is often more important for a high percentile than learning how to solve every single question.
